Abstract
The birth of the era of Postmodernism marked the end of the modern era and at the same time rejecting all modern thought because it was considered old fashioned and incompatible with today’s developments. The spirit of the era of Postmodernism is marked by progress in all areas of human life, both technology, science, as well as philosophy, theology and religion. The purpose of this paper is to understand the theological study of Postmodernism and its impact on the church. This research uses a descriptive research method with a literature review approach, namely finding facts with the right interpretation of various literatures and the results of research needed in writing the existing topic from various literatures and the results of a research needed in writing the spelling of exciting topic. Conclusion: Postmodernism poses a serious threat to the church because it adheres to the principle that truth is subjective and determined by individuals which is a person’s personal right, there is no absolute and final truth because everything is relative, meaning that the Word of God is no longer absolute truth and Jesus is not the only truth, only Saviour. This means that Postmodernism is contrary to the Bible which is a source of teaching for Christianity
